Nurses in general hospitals tend to place a higher priority on physical care than on psychosocial care (Gillette et al 1996; Swan and McVicar 1990; Whitehead and Mayou 1989). It has been claimed ‘basic human skills are seriously lacking in the nursing workforce today, at least in many acute settings’ (Armstrong 2000, p.27). This is largely attributed to insufficient psychiatric and mental health content in undergraduate courses to prepare nurses for mental health care (Wynaden et al 2000; Happell 1998).
